Output f286422451abe1e065b489167d56792e7b1ff75ff0be0d15a61bfffbf6e33d86:0

value
2690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db96e2ba0be7271761c9e8f4157c4fcb5636ed8a OP_EQUAL
address
3Mi6fGpBaYV2jP4MsLYJdu9ptshUb9wGeU
transaction
f286422451abe1e065b489167d56792e7b1ff75ff0be0d15a61bfffbf6e33d86
spent
true